Govt under fire over rising GP fees

A federal government freeze forcing patients to pay more to see a doctor will be lifted before the election if one of the nation's most powerful lobby groups gets its way.

Australian Medical Association president Brian Owler says the four-year indexation freeze on the Medicare rebate, paid when patients visit a GP, will remain a "big" electoral headache for the government going into the next election.

"The AMA and others will work to have it abolished before the election," he said on Thursday.
